TSG Hoffenheim: Angelo Stiller rules out winter transfer

Only 11 minutes of play at TSG

TSG 1899 Hoffenheim started the season well under new coach André Breitenreiter and is fourth in the Champions League with 13 points from seven games. U21 international Angelo Stiller, who was mostly a regular last year, has had surprisingly little to do with it. After an injury in preparation, the defensive midfielder is struggling to catch up and has only been on the field for eleven minutes in the Bundesliga.

The strong new signing Grischa Prömel (27), Dennis Geiger (24) and the more offensive Christoph Baumgartner (23) are currently ahead in Breitenreiter’s 3-5-2 system in midfield, as is TSG record player Sebastian Rudy (32), mostly as a joker, you get more bets. When asked about this, Stiller, who was last twice in the starting XI for the U21s, said “table football“: “I had a difficult preparation, was injured, so I didn’t get to my fitness. We succeeded. The players who play my position are doing well at the moment. So it’s clear that the coach isn’t rotating.”

Stiller, who is committed until 2025, is thinking of a winter transfer, but that’s not why. When asked if he could rule out such a thing, FC Bayern’s home-grown child said: “Yes, I think so.”
